Anteaters Strike Gold in 110th Minute Again

IRVINE, Calif. --- UC Irvine used every minute to get a win once again scoring with 28 seconds left in double overtime to drop Cal Poly, 2-1, Sunday afternoon in Anteater Stadium.

Much like Friday's ending, the 'Eaters (7-5-1, 3-0-0) set up just around midfield for a free kick that keeper Maddie Newsom punted toward goal into a mass of humanity in the middle of the box. The ball found Shelby Lee's head that bounced inside the post for the go-ahead goal in the 110th minute.
 
The match got back to double overtime from a five-minute span of goals in the second half. The Anteaters made the first mark in the 56th minute from a Reema Bzeih corner kick. She planted a ball long to the far post finding Aleah Kelley who would head the ball back across to Claire Grouwinkel to redirect it home with a head past Mustang keeper Sophia Brown for a 1-0 UC Irvine lead.
 
Cal Poly (1-10-4, 1-2-1) got the benefit of an Anteater mistake in the 61st minute as the Mustangs charged toward the box and the ball would bounce up and catch an 'Eater on the arm to award a penalty kick to Cal Poly. Megan Hansen would step up and convert tying things at 1-1 with nearly half an hour remaining.

The 'Eaters emerged with more of the opportunities to score starting with Lee and Elizabeth Hutchison missing narrowly in the first half. Lili Andino nearly struck first on the scoreboard in the opening minute of the second half scoring a goal, but it was taken away by a ball off the arm. UCI nearly locked the game up in regulation as the 82nd minute rolled around and Alex Karlowitsch whipped a shot off left wing off the crossbar. The rebound fell to Amber Huff who put the ball back on frame, but was caught by Brown for one of her six saves on the day.

Maddie Newsom and her 'Eaters would finish with the 2-1 victory, however, and added two saves giving her 190 in her career in what was her 30th victory of her career.

Shelby Lee's goal is the fifth of her career as she's scored in consecutive matches now, and the first game-winner of her career. Claire Grouwinkel also scored, her team-leading sixth of the season.

UC Irvine remains atop the Big West conference standings earning all nine possible points through the first three matches. UCI will get its first road Big West tests now as it heads to unbeaten UC Riverside Wednesday, Oct. 11 before continuing on to UC Davis next weekend.
